Glamorgan CCC Secure Sean Dickson on Two-Year Deal from Somerset

The South African-born batsman will join Glamorgan at the conclusion of the 2025 season, bolstering their batting lineup for the upcoming campaigns.

Glamorgan County Cricket Club has officially announced the signing of prolific batsman Sean Dickson from Somerset CCC. The South African-born right-handed batter will join the Welsh county on a two-year deal starting from the end of the 2025 season.

Dickson, who has been a consistent performer in the County Championship, brings a wealth of experience to Glamorgan’s batting lineup. Known for his technical proficiency and ability to play long innings, the 34-year-old has been a mainstay in Somerset’s middle order since joining them in 2020.

“We’re delighted to secure Sean’s signature for the 2026 and 2027 seasons. His experience and quality will be invaluable to our batting group as we look to compete across all formats.”

– Mark Wallace, Director of Cricket at Glamorgan CCC

Sean Dickson first made his mark in county cricket with Kent, where he scored a magnificent triple century against Northamptonshire in 2017. That remarkable innings of 318 runs announced his arrival on the county scene and demonstrated his capability to play marathon innings.

During his time with Somerset, Dickson has been part of a squad that has consistently challenged for honors across all formats. His contributions have been particularly valuable in the County Championship, where his ability to anchor the innings has provided stability to Somerset’s batting lineup.
